‘I have never seen England on a charge like this’

By Eric November 16, 2025

In his latest column for BBC Sport, World Cup champion Matt Dawson provides an insightful analysis of England’s thrilling comeback against New Zealand in the Rugby World Cup. The match showcased England’s resilience and tactical prowess, culminating in a hard-fought victory that has reinvigorated the team’s hopes in the tournament. Dawson highlights the strategic adjustments made by England’s coaching staff, which were pivotal in turning the tide during the match. The team’s ability to adapt and respond under pressure is a testament to their preparation and mental fortitude, qualities that are essential at this level of competition.

Dawson places particular emphasis on the standout performances of players like Ollie Lawrence and Henry Pollock. Lawrence, with his dynamic skillset, demonstrated exceptional ball-handling and defensive capabilities, which were crucial in breaking through New Zealand’s formidable defense. His agility and vision on the field allowed England to maintain momentum and capitalize on scoring opportunities. Meanwhile, Pollock’s infectious energy and relentless work rate were instrumental in energizing the team, especially during crucial phases of the game. Dawson notes that Pollock’s ability to rally his teammates and maintain high intensity exemplifies the spirit needed for success in high-stakes matches.

As England progresses in the tournament, Dawson’s analysis serves as a reminder of the importance of teamwork, adaptability, and individual brilliance in rugby. The victory over New Zealand not only boosts England’s confidence but also sets the stage for their upcoming challenges in the World Cup. With players like Lawrence and Pollock leading the charge, England appears well-equipped to face their next opponents, making them a team to watch as the tournament unfolds. Dawson’s reflections resonate with rugby fans, encapsulating the thrill of the game and the potential for greatness that lies within the England squad.
